Our review of the Atturo Trail Blade ATS finds a durable all-terrain tire made for Jeeps, light trucks, and SUVs that prioritizes off-road capability without sacrificing a comfortable on-road ride. The single biggest reason to consider these tires is the combination of a self-cleaning, optimized tread and an aggressive Quartermaster QSE-5 inspired sidewall that boosts traction and gives a rugged appearance, while still backing the product with a 50,000 mile limited tread life warranty for long-term value.

Key Features

  • Optimized tread pattern: Improves traction and handling across dirt, gravel, and paved surfaces for confident multi-surface performance.
  • Aggressive sidewall design: Quartermaster knife inspired patterns add a bold look and extra bite on soft edges when off-road.
  • Large tread blocks and deep sipes: Enhance grip in wet and snowy conditions while maintaining stability at speed.
  • Wide tread channels: Evacuate water from the contact patch to reduce hydroplaning risk and improve wet traction.
  • Self-cleaning tread: Expels mud, rocks, and debris to keep traction consistent during off-road use and minimize road noise.
  • 50,000 mile limited warranty: Provides peace of mind for long-term wear expectations on light trucks and SUVs.

Who It's For

The Atturo Trail Blade ATS is aimed at drivers who use their vehicle for a mix of highway commuting and regular off-road excursions, including trail runs, light mud, and gravel roads. It suits Jeep owners and light truck drivers who want a durable all-terrain that looks aggressive and performs reliably in wet or snowy conditions.

Those who primarily need the quietest highway touring tire or who demand extreme mud-terrain performance should look elsewhere; this tire balances on-road comfort and off-road traction rather than being a specialized, ultra-quiet touring or hardcore mud tire.

Specifications

Size LT265/70R18 (265/70/18)
Load Range Load Range E, 10-ply
Speed & Load Rating 124/121S
Tread Type All-Terrain, self-cleaning pattern
Warranty 50,000 mile limited tread life warranty
Design Highlight Quartermaster QSE-5 knife inspired aggressive sidewall
